An Ideal Choice
FRP is a composite material made from a combination of glass fiber and polyester resin. Thanks to this special composition, FRP exhibits superior properties such as high mechanical strength, heat resistance, and chemical resistance. Furthermore, its resistance to corrosion makes it an ideal choice for use in humid and aggressive environments.

Advantages of Using FRP
- Lightweight
FRP is significantly lighter than traditional materials. This feature reduces transportation, assembly, and labor costs, while also decreasing the load on structures.
- High Strength
Thanks to its high strength, FRP is resistant to impacts, wind, and other external factors. This ensures the longevity of structures.
- Corrosion and Chemical Resistance
FRP does not rust and is resistant to most chemicals. This property makes it ideal for use in harsh conditions, such as coastal areas, and in industrial structures.
- Thermal Insulation
FRP is a good thermal insulation material. This helps save energy in buildings and creates a comfortable indoor environment.
- Flexible Design
FRP can be easily produced in different shapes and sizes. This provides freedom to architects and designers, allowing them to create aesthetic and functional structures.
Areas of Use
The versatile nature of FRP allows it to have a wide range of uses in the construction sector. The main areas of use are:
- Roof and Facade Cladding
FRP is frequently preferred for roof and facade cladding due to its aesthetic appearance and durability. Its waterproofing property protects buildings from external factors.
- Prefabricated Structures
FRP panels enable the rapid and economical construction of prefabricated structures. Its lightness and ease of assembly facilitate the transportation and installation of prefabricated structures.
- Water Tanks and Pools
FRP's waterproofing property ensures its safe use in the construction of water tanks and pools.
- Industrial Structures
Thanks to its chemical resistance and durability, FRP is an ideal material for factories, warehouses, and other industrial structures.
- Decorative Elements
FRP can also be used in the production of decorative elements such as columns, arches, and railings. Its aesthetic appearance and design flexibility support creativity in architectural projects.
